CSS里的style标签内为什么要加html注释符
2015-10-14 13:58
423 查看
CSS里的style标签内为什么要加html注释符
今天俺终于搞懂了CSS里的style标签内为什么要加<!-- -->html注释符
说来惭愧啊,搞开发也有那么点时间了吧,经常看在style标签里含有这个html的注释符号,想去搞懂原因,还真没找着,上网没找到原因,可能是自己查找的方式不对吧。
下面步入正题。
为什么要加这个注释符呢??
其实在style里面加上< !-- -- >的原因是,有些低版本的浏览器不能识别style标记,会把style里面的内容以文本形式直接显示到页面上,为避免这种情况,最好加上注释符,不让它显示。
不单只是高低浏览器版本的问题,不同的浏览器,解释的标准也不一样
当浏览器能够识别style标签时候,<!-- -->这对标签就会过滤掉,继续执行核心的样式代码;
当浏览器识别不了style标签的时候,<!-- -->就发挥作用了,也就是注释作用!就是把内容屏蔽掉,不让显示出来 。
相关文章推荐
- 纯CSS3仿Windows phone加载动画特效
- Java实现缓存页面中不变的元素,JS,CSS,图片等
- CSS3 Box-sizing属性以及解决兼容性的一些做法
- css规范
- html +CSS+div学习——第二课
- HTML+CSS+div学习——第一课
- CSS中常见的长度单位
- CSS中常见的长度单位
- 用CSS绘制梯形
- outline轮廓线在不同CSS样式下的表现
- CSS块级元素和行内元素
- CSS3自定义滚动条样式 -webkit-scrollbar
- 获取元素CSS值之getComputedStyle方法熟悉
- css样式内联式,外联式,嵌入式的格式是什么?
- 父元素与子元素之间的margin-top问题(css hack)
- 在MVC中使用dotless后台动态解析LESSCSS的学习笔记
- LessCss学习笔记
- CSS3:background-size背景图片尺寸属性
- css3 box-sizing属性
- css控制div左侧列表排列